Output 21a39376f4e1df21d787db0bc48b678e5798ac5871bc77c46dceea3ff64d080a: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1718bed9d46efe6c5d6c1d3d6235c0e9eee7c756 OP_EQUAL
address
33o97JbKXsvuj5biRdARRUx8VxZcHqdeNh
transaction
21a39376f4e1df21d787db0bc48b678e5798ac5871bc77c46dceea3ff64d080a
spent
true